2176:给出不同时段的速度和持续时间,计算路程。
简单题。
简单题。
#include<stdio.h>
#include<iostream>
using namespace std;
int main()
{
int n;
int s;
int t;
int prev;
int dist;
while(1)
{
prev=0;
dist=0;
cin>>n;
if(n==-1)
break;
for(int i=0;i<n;i++)
{
cin>>s;
cin>>t;
dist+=s*(t-prev);
prev=t;
}
cout<<dist<<" miles"<<endl;
}
}